The University of Maryland committee of faculty colleagues selected Katharine G. Abraham as part of the 2021 Class of Distinguished University Professors (DUP).  Professor Abraham was selected for her research and expertise in labor economics, and extraordinary service within the federal government.

Distinguished University Professor is the highest honor the University of Maryland bestows on a faculty member for their contributions to their field of research. and is a title that is reserved for a very small select group of distinguished scholars.
